For many years my chicken of choice was boneless chicken breasts and the reasoning was simple. They were easy; that boneless business made much quicker work of many meals. Then one day, enter boneless chicken thighs. Goodbye chicken breasts!

I have always been more fond of the darker meat in chicken; less prone to drying out certainly but I simply think it is more flavorful. Now that it's readily available as boneless pieces, it's taken over 1st Place in my heart for favorite chicken. Using it in this dish with apples, maple syrup and walnuts that are complemented with a honey mustard dressing was a total win and all we needed was a bright green vegetable on the side with some crusty bread and it was perfect.

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350º
  2. Rinse chicken under cold running water and pat completely dry with paper towels.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Heat oil in an ovenproof skillet set over medium-high heat, add garlic and chicken thighs and sauté until browned, about 3 minutes per side.
  3. Remove chicken from skillet and arrange apple slices in skillet. In a small bowl, combine maple syrup and chopped walnuts. Spoon half of the walnut mixture over the sliced apples. Place the browned chicken breasts on top of the apple slices and spoon remaining walnut mixture over the chicken.
  4. Whisk together the honey, Dijon mustard and olive oil and drizzle over the chicken and then sprinkle it with thyme. Cover with lid and bake for 20 to 25 minutes, or until chicken is cooked through and apple slices are fork tender.
  5. Transfer to serving platter and serve.
